Face Scrub

Dry skin on your face doesn’t just look unsightly but it can also lead to even further issues, including itchiness, pimples, and breakouts. Using a good face scrub should become a part of your regular routine to clean away any dead skin on your face and reveal the fresh, glowing skin underneath. There are plenty of options designed just for men that will leave your skin feeling and looking its best after each use. And, you can simply add them to your regular hygiene routine when washing your face every few days. For best results, don’t use them in the shower – or be sure to use colder water, as this will close your pores and help you avoid oily skin. If you tend to be prone to breakouts or acne, a medicated face scrub and face wash can do wonders for clearing up your skin.

Beard Grooming Kit

If you have a beard, you probably know just how much of a difference it can make when you really look after it. And with beards definitely a trend that isn’t going anywhere any time soon, any bearded gentleman needs a good grooming kit of his own. Washing and combing your beard on a regular basis will keep it looking smooth and soft, and you can apply oils to avoid hair matting and knots that can leave you looking scruffy and unkempt. If you normally have your beard trimmer and maintained by your barber, a good beard grooming kit can help you maintain the achieved look for longer and help you to continue looking and feeling your best between visits.

Hair Trimmer

In between visits to your barber, a good trimming tool can help you keep yourself looking sleek and groomed at all times. You can use a multi-tool trimmer for many different things, including keeping your beard at the right length, tidying up your sideburns, and removing any flyaway hairs from around your face. If you tend to get hairs growing from your nose or around your ears, a quick once-over with the trimmer can leave you looking fresh and groomed within minutes. You can also use a hair trimmer to shape your eyebrows and tidy up your hairline if you tend to get flyaway hairs in this area.

Moisturizer

Keeping your skin soft and hydrated is crucial, so every man who is serious about looking and feeling great should have a high-quality moisturiser in his grooming kit. Ideally, you should have two – one that you apply in the morning as part of your getting ready routine, and one to apply before bed to help your skin during the night where most of the healing and regeneration work takes place. If you spend a lot of time outdoors, it’s a good idea to get a day moisturiser that contains a high SPF to protect your skin from the harmful effects of the sun. At night, a thicker cream can be applied to your skin so that you wake up feeling soft and smooth.

Manicure Kit

Keeping your nails trim and clean can make a huge difference to the appearance of your hands. A good manicure kit should include several tools such as nail clippers, tools to tidy up your cuticles, and a good nail brush to remove any dirt from underneath your nails. If you work in a very manual job or are often getting your hands dirty, a good manicure kit could be a must. If you suffer from a habit of nail-biting, you may want to consider a kit that includes an anti-biting solution that you can brush onto your nails – this has a foul taste and will quickly help you kick the habit and allow your nails to strengthen and grow.
